Home Instead West Exeter & Teignbridge and Home Instead South Devon are delighted to announce that Care Manager Joanne Palmer has been shortlisted for the Outstanding Contribution category at the Leading Women in Care Awards 2026—one of the most prestigious accolades in the UK care sector.

This national award recognises women who have made an exceptional impact through dedication, leadership, and compassion. Joanne was nominated by her team in recognition of the remarkable difference she has made to the lives of clients and colleagues alike over many years.

Selected from thousands of nominations across the UK, Joanne is one of just six finalists in her category. In an additional achievement, she is also one of only two Home Instead colleagues nationwide to be shortlisted this year.
